Output 629dbc32cb0959ed9bb874540cb842eecfa8cb444adcf7dea42f48c143bc50ef:0

value
44854
script pubkey
OP_0 OP_PUSHBYTES_20 173065c213ac19f12524d13463d94fe649e0c3a5
address
bc1qzucxtssn4svlzffy6y6x8k20uey7psa9h8dx66
transaction
629dbc32cb0959ed9bb874540cb842eecfa8cb444adcf7dea42f48c143bc50ef
confirmations
17346
spent
true